However, recent research suggests that this passion for sound may be coming at a significant cost. A concerning study has revealed that 83% of Gen Z music enthusiasts have reported experiencing auditory issues following their attendance at live events.<\/p>\n<p>### The Reality of Tinnitus and Hearing Damage<br \/>\nThe Royal National Institute for Deaf People (RNID) recently unveiled their <a href=\"https:\/\/rnid.org.uk\/2026\/08\/dont-lose-the-music-music-events-leave-gen-z-with-hearing-damage\/\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er external nofollow\" target=\"_blank\">Don\u2019t Lose The Music campaign<\/a>, which highlights the precarious state of ear health among those aged 20 to 29. The findings are stark: the vast majority of respondents have dealt with symptoms like persistent ringing, buzzing, or a muffled sensation after being exposed to high-decibel environments. <\/p>\n<p>Even more alarming is the frequency of these incidents. Approximately 10% of those surveyed suffer from these auditory disturbances on a regular basis. Despite the prevalence of these warning signs, only one in five concert-goers consistently utilizes ear protection.<\/p>\n<p>### Debunking Myths About Ear Protection<br \/>\nA major hurdle in promoting ear health is the persistence of outdated stigmas. Many music fans avoid using earplugs due to the misconception that they degrade the fidelity of the music or are inherently uncomfortable to wear for long durations. <\/p>\n<p>Modern technology has rendered these concerns largely obsolete. High-fidelity earplugs are now designed to lower the volume evenly across frequencies, preserving the clarity of the music while protecting the delicate structures of the inner ear. To help fans navigate these options, the <a href=\"https:\/\/rnid.org.uk\/dont-lose-the-music\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er external nofollow\">RNID<\/a> has provided comprehensive <a href=\"https:\/\/rnid.org.uk\/dont-lose-the-music\/choose-your-earplugs\/\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er external nofollow\" target=\"_blank\">guidance<\/a> on selecting the right equipment tailored to specific environments, whether you are at a small club or a massive outdoor festival.<\/p>\n<p>### A Warning from the Front Lines<br \/>\nThe danger of ignoring these symptoms is best illustrated by those who work within the industry. Natalie, a DJ and content creator known as KEM, serves as an advocate for the campaign. She shares a cautionary tale that resonates with many: &#8220;I\u2019d often experience ringing in my ears after events, but assumed it was normal because it always went away &#8211; until one day it didn\u2019t.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p>Her experience underscores a vital truth: temporary ringing, known as tinnitus, is often the first sign of permanent damage. Just as you wouldn&#8217;t ignore a persistent pain in your knee after a run, you shouldn&#8217;t dismiss the warning signals your ears are sending. By normalizing the use of earplugs, the music community can ensure that the next generation of fans can continue to enjoy live performances for decades to come.<\/p>\n<p><a class=\"echo_read_more\" href=\"https:\/\/djmag.com\/news\/83-of-gen-z-have-experienced-hearing-issues-after-live-music-events-study-finds\" target=\"_blank\"> \u00bb More Info >>><\/a><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>A startling new study reveals that 83% of Gen Z music fans are walking away from live concerts with ringing ears and hearing damage.
